SMC Basketball Players Pick Schools:

Jonathan Smith, a quick, high-scoring 5-9 guard who made all-conference at Santa Monica College last season, has signed a letter-of-intent with Cal State Northridge.

Center Kam-Ron Clay has signed with Chicago State.

SMC Coach Trevor Shickman recalls that he advised Smith to transfer last season because Smith’s academics weren’t good and his shot selection lacked discipline. Instead of leaving, Smith passed three difficult courses in summer school and then became a true point guard with improvement in his passing.

Clay contributed rebounding and defense to the Corsairs but was injured and didn’t play in the latter part of the season. He has resumed workouts.Other SMC sophomores haven’t yet secured scholarships. LeBoise Gladden and Efren Lawrence are candidates for four-year schools and guard Jun Nakanishi has drawn interest from a professional team in Japan.
